Abstract
The neutral current e±p cross section has been measured up to values of Bjorken x≅1 with the ZEUS detector at HERA using an integrated luminosity of 187pb-1 of e-p and 142pb-1 of e+p collisions at s=318GeV. Differential cross sections in x and Q2, the exchanged boson virtuality, are presented for Q2≥725GeV2. An improved reconstruction method and greatly increased amount of data allows a finer binning in the high-x region of the neutral current cross section and leads to a measurement with much improved precision compared to a similar earlier analysis. The measurements are compared to Standard Model expectations based on a variety of recent parton distribution functions.
